Transaction 2e53e053289df68b93d9eea613d584ce97edf5d08523cc04657bd5127af7b790
1 Input
1 Output
-
2e53e053289df68b93d9eea613d584ce97edf5d08523cc04657bd5127af7b790:0
- value
- 499275
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5cdb87171f4868c524afd8b5c87eab020e96cd9
- address
- bc1quhxmsut37jrgc5j2lk94epl2kqswjmxeahzyrd